MBSE: Standard Software Brings SysML v2 to Xcelerator

With the standard software Systems Modeler for SysML v2, Siemens Digital Industries Software aims to support users in managing the complexity of products with mechanical, electrical, electronic, and software components. Additionally, the software is described as the next milestone in Siemens' collaboration with IBM and is supported by IBM Rhapsody Systems Engineering. Systems Modeler for SysML v2 was developed to enhance collaboration among development teams involved in complex product development. It uses SysML v2 models to exchange data between various applications and domains, such as electrical engineering and mechanical engineering.

The solution offers integration with Teamcenter and connects the systems-oriented digital thread based on open standards. It integrates data and processes from the areas of mechanics, electronics, electrical engineering, and software. This is intended to facilitate the transfer of system designs to downstream teams for domain-specific development while maintaining full traceability. Additionally, it supports comprehensive change management throughout the entire project to ensure that all changes are tracked.

Requirements Management: AI Tool Reduces Effort in Analyzing Specifications

Until now, specifications—often extensive requirement catalogs from clients for the development of components, software, or automotive systems—were processed manually. Conti experts previously invested up to 37,500 work hours in requirements management over the course of a development project in what is known as Requirements Engineering. As the complexity and scope of specifications continue to increase, it becomes all the more critical to structure requirements management more efficiently.

With the new digital analysis tool "AI-based Requirements Engineering Tool," developed by Continental in close collaboration with Microsoft and the global IT consultancy NTT Data, the company aims to revolutionize its requirements management in product development. The digital tool was implemented using "Microsoft Azure AI Services." With the support of artificial intelligence, even the most extensive specifications can be read and analyzed easily and almost error-free. Individual requirements and project tasks can be automatically assigned to the respective Continental development centers. This can reduce the effort for a traditionally time-consuming task by up to 80 percent.

Integration: Seamless Integration of Product Architecture And Engineering

The success of a product is known to be determined during the phase of defining the product architecture. Key parameters such as functionality, variants, modules, cost structures, and supply chains are defined here. With Metus, the proven modeling tool from PricewaterhouseCoopers (PwC), these early product concepts can be represented in an interdisciplinary manner. PwC and BCT Technology AG have now jointly developed the interface starter package TC2METUS based on Siemens’ standard solution Active Integration Gateway (AIG). This enables a seamless data chain based on standard software, from the initial architecture through PLM processes (Requirements Management, System Design, Configuration, etc.) in Teamcenter. With the subsequent operational implementation in ERP systems, the "end-to-end" process is completed.

The starter package TC4METUS includes

  • preconfigured use cases,
  • prefabricated T4EA pipelines, as well as
  • a Teamcenter workflow template.

The integration is reportedly based on scalable, future-proof interface technology and can be easily customized and extended through low-code applications like the Pipeline Designer and TC-Preferences. Typical use cases for the solution include the structured transfer of product data, such as the creation and updating of product structures, as well as the integration of variant information (variant groups, families, features, rules, and criteria). The era of isolated systems and resulting inefficiencies is now a thing of the past, the companies state. Thanks to the new interface, all participating teams work along the entire value chain with a consistent data basis. This is intended to create ideal conditions for fast change cycles, shortened development times, and early cost optimization.
